我想用Java实现PMT函数(来自Excel)。 PMT函数的公式为:
(D7*D9/12)/(1-(1+D9/12)^(-(D11/12)*12))
地点:
- D7 = 融资金额
- D9 = 比率
- D11 = 期限
例如
D7 = $1,00,000,
D9 = 10%,
D11 = 36
此处 PMT 函数的输出,即每月付款将为 $3,226.72
请谁帮我用Java计算这个函数值。
最佳答案
您可以使用 Apache POI:
http://poi.apache.org/apidocs/org/apache/poi/ss/formula/functions/FinanceLib.html
它拯救了我的一天:D
使用示例:
FinanceLib.pmt(0.00740260861, 180, -984698, 0, false)
参数:利率
、月份
、现值
、 future 值
、开头句点
(或末尾)
关于java - Java 中的 Excel PMT 函数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7827352/